Output 6244e23c02a5c7bc75f9201a9692ad217dfcb9708fa90184fc6f2c165215f73c:3

value
939385
script pubkey
OP_0 OP_PUSHBYTES_32 31d780202b645e080cca73c3e88d3d1ca39f33d824e455c2d55e9ce24c29054f
address
bc1qx8tcqgptv30qsrx2w0p73rfarj3e7v7cynj9tsk4t6wwynpfq48sdy2xvk
transaction
6244e23c02a5c7bc75f9201a9692ad217dfcb9708fa90184fc6f2c165215f73c
spent
true